My Apple watch is not switching on.
Hi,
My Apple Watch is not switching on even after 2 hours of charging. When connected to the charger, it shows a green charging sign but it goes red as soon as it’s off the charger. Any thoughts?
thanks!
The first thing you should do to try and fix this issue is to press and hold the side button on your watch to see if the Apple Watch turns back on. If it doesn't, you can try a hard restart by pressing both the side button and digital crown for 10 seconds.

Does the watch ping when you place it on the charging puck which is powered?
Using a second watch which is working see if the puck and the charger are working. If they are then your battery likely needs replacement. if the display or sensor plate came off you might not have mounted them on fully so water/sweat could have entered damaging things too!
